			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Great blog, thank you.</p>
<p>When registering a device, the BYOD end user gets a prompt asking &#8220;Allow organization to manage this device&#8221;. If unticked, it will register with Azure AD and allow terms of use to be accepted, but the WIP policy will not apply.</p>
<p>If the box is left ticked, it will work as intended.</p>
<p>I wonder if there is a way to force the tick box &#8220;Allow organization to manage device&#8221;?</p>
<p>Many thanks</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In reply to <a href="https://inthecloud247.com/force-windows-information-protection-with-conditional-access/#comment-52862">Peter Klapwijk</a>.</p>
<p>Hi Peter,<br />
i have an update. On monday thinks started to work as expected. Chrome works in enterprise context and is protected app. I noticed that some icons on Intune portal are changed, so maybe Microsoft pushed updates during weekend. Also, i changed Publisher for Chrome app. It was O=GOOGLE INC&#8230; to O=GOOGLE LLC, L=MOUNTAIN VIEW, S=CA, C=US. Even, i tried with Google LLC before, but it didn&#8217;t work. </p>
<p>BUT, i overlooked fact that you are talking about devices without enrollment. Expirence i described was with enrolled device. </p>
<p>On device without enrolmnet, still can&#8217;t access corp dana with Chrome.<br />
But looks like, it is expected:</p>
<p>&#8211; Only enlightened apps can be managed without device Enrollment.</p>
